Stirling

From Simple English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Stirling (Scottish Gaelic: Sruighlea) is a city in the middle of Scotland. Stirling was very important a long time ago because it is at the centre of Scotland. Battles were fought at Bannockburn and Stirling Bridge, and there is a castle in the city. During part of the Middle Ages it was the capital of the Kingdom of Scotland.
